IT question

wrong forum etc etc


the machine im on at the moment is a p4 2.8 with 512 RAM running XP pro sp1, the 20Gb HDD is only 5 Gb full

so can anyone come up with any reasons why the hell its so SLOW
and, more importantly, why, every so often, explorer crashes for no apparent reason, and does random popups for no apparent reason

i have scanned it with F secure (our virus thing) and lavasoft ad aware and they are both coming up clean, also had a look at the C drive and cant see any obvious dodgy programmes.


anyone any suggestions?

Re: IT question

Run a different spyware scan, defrag your HDDs, run MSCONFIG and check what's starting on your machine everytime you boot, check device manager for dodgy drivers/entries, try removing random pieces of non-essential hardware, update your drivers for everything.

If that fails, reformat cleanly and reinstall. If it's still slow then it's almost certainly some form of hardware problem. You could try swapping the RAM with another machine if you've got that option available.

I had a similar problem recently, reformatted and it was all fine. Windows just gets clogged up with crap over time.

Re: IT question

Failing harddrive, incorrect northbridge drivers or bad RAM, incorrect southbridge drivers or failing HDD controller, inadequate cooling on the processor causing it to throttle back to protect itself, harddrive using the wrong UDMA mode or worse still stuck in PIO mode...

In other words, it could be a number of things. Find a system diagnostics tool and run it.

Re: IT question

I would avoid anything other than Lavasofts Ad-Aware or Safer-Networkings Spybot - Search and Destroy programs. There are other genuine spyware programs out there but far too many of them are fake and just add to the problem.

Also, with both of these utilities absolutely make sure you are using the most up to date version of the software, and I don't just mean having the latest definition files. Lavasoft are discontinuing support for Ad-Aware v6, download Ad-Aware SE if you do not have it already, not only will it make sure you have up-to-date definition files but this version seems to do a more thourough job of killing the nasties. Same applies to Spybot, current at version 1.3 I think, they had a couple of flaky beta releases prior to this that were not detecting spyware properly so make sure you have the most up to date version.

Run both programs and restart your machine after to make sure nothing is still resident in memory.

Also check for flaky drivers, get the latest version for each device you have many have known stability issues. Nvidia drivers and some Wi-Fi card drivers are known to cause these problems.

Put your Windows XP CD in your machine or make sure the CAB files are available to that machine somewhere then type the following in the Start->Run box: sfc /scannow
This will check all the important system files that Windows requires for problems and if it finds any that do not match it will copy a fresh version over the top.

That should get you off to a good start hopefully.
